Owner Review Summary
Distilled from Google reviews — see what pet owners actually say
👍What Pet Owners Praised
Owners consistently praise the team’s compassionate, thorough care and clear, honest communication. Many highlight knowledgeable vets who diagnose issues accurately, follow up after visits, and never pressure unnecessary procedures. Reviewers mention friendly, efficient reception, timely reminders, and the ability to accommodate urgent or same‑day needs. Long‑term clients repeatedly say they trust the clinic with everything from routine vaccines to complex or lifelong conditions.
💬Common Feedback & Suggestions
A minority of reviews mention higher prices compared with other clinics, with a few feeling specific procedures or visits were costly. Scheduling rigidity came up several times, including strict late‑arrival policies and an instance of a short‑notice reschedule; one person also noted the hours sometimes conflict with work. A couple of reviewers felt care was less thorough after a favourite vet retired, and one or two were dissatisfied with outcomes for minor procedures. Overall, concerns are occasional against a backdrop of strongly positive experiences.

🐾Tips for Pet Owners
- Arrive a few minutes early—several reviewers noted a strict late‑arrival policy.
- If you need urgent care, call ahead; many pets were accommodated the same day or even within the hour.
- Discuss treatment options and budgets up front—staff are described as transparent and willing to tailor plans.
- Prepare questions for the visit; vets here are praised for thorough explanations and follow‑ups.
- Parking is available and convenient, which can help with nervous pets or large carriers.

Queensway West Animal Hospital is located at 60 Colchester Square, Ottawa, ON K2K 2Z9. No subway, light-rail, or train station was found within walking distance, so driving may be easiest; pet owners can also check Google Maps or OC Transpo for the nearest local bus route. Nearby parking options include Eagleson and OC Transpo - Eagleson Park & Ride, both about a 6-minute walk away.
Queensway West Animal Hospital asks pet owners to call ahead to confirm current opening hours. This is especially helpful if you need a same-day or urgent appointment.
You can contact Queensway West Animal Hospital by phone at (613) 271-8387. Call ahead to confirm hours, appointment availability, and any visit requirements.
To book an appointment at Queensway West Animal Hospital, call the clinic directly to enquire about available times. Reviews mention same-day and urgent appointment accommodation, but availability should be confirmed in advance.
Veterinary consultation fees vary by clinic in Canada and are not set by a government-published fee schedule; provincial health insurance such as OHIP does not cover pets. Call the clinic for a current quote, and ask for an itemized written estimate before procedures or treatment plans. Pet insurance and third-party payment-plan options may be available in Canada generally, but you should confirm any options directly with the clinic.
Most Canadian veterinary clinics commonly accept Interac debit, Visa or Mastercard, and tap-and-go payments such as Apple Pay or Google Pay. Some clinics may also support pet-insurance claims or third-party payment plans, so call ahead to confirm what Queensway West Animal Hospital currently accepts.
